Tanglewood Tales. On the second day of this month, the baby girl of Mr. and Mrs. L.G. Treadwell overturned a pot of coffee, receiving the boiling contents on its breast and stomach. After suffering intensely for over a week, on the ninth the angel of death released the little spirit and on the tenth the wee form was laid to rest in the Hugh Wilson cemetery. Mr. and Mrs. Treadwell have the sympathy of the entire community. When this sad accident occurred Mr. Treadwell was about moving to Sillsbee, and on Thursday left, taking his wife and remaining two children with him. The family will be greatly missed. The Rockdale Reporter and Messenger (Rockdale, Tex.), Vol. 38, No. 32, Ed. 1 Thursday, October 19, 1911
